Brazil Suicide Bomber Attacks Supreme Court

by Mae De Vera, LAWIN.news November 14, 2024
written by Mae De Vera, LAWIN.news November 14, 2024
A body lies outside the Supreme Court in Brasília, Brazil, following an explosion, Wednesday, Nov. 13, 2024. (AP Photo/Eraldo Peres)
113

A man attempted to enter Brazil’s Supreme Court on Wednesday, leading to a self-inflicted explosion that forced the evacuation of justices and staff. The incident occurred in Brasília, outside the iconic Plaza of the Three Powers where the Supreme Court is located. Authorities have identified the man as the lone perpetrator in the attack.

Security personnel quickly responded to the scene, ensuring the area was evacuated and secure. Law enforcement combed through the site to confirm there were no additional threats. The explosive device the man used reportedly detonated during his attempt to breach the court, resulting in his death.

Witnesses described hearing two distinct explosions. The initial blast was followed by a second, louder explosion that caused panic among bystanders and prompted the immediate evacuation of the court. The entire process was executed swiftly, with law enforcement and emergency responders arriving promptly.

Officials stated that the motive behind the attack remains unclear, but investigations are ongoing. Authorities are reviewing surveillance footage and any available evidence to understand the perpetrator’s intentions. The method of the attack and the explosives used are being scrutinized by bomb experts from the federal police.

The Supreme Court building was quickly cordoned off, and court activities were suspended. Justices and staff were escorted to safety, with no injuries reported among them. The evacuation process was orderly, reflecting well-practiced emergency protocols.

The Brazilian government, led by President Luiz Inácio Lula da Silva, has expressed its commitment to ensuring the safety of its judicial institutions. The President was not present at the palace during the incident but has been kept informed about the ongoing investigation.

The attack has raised concerns about security in key government areas, especially with the upcoming G20 summit. Security measures are expected to be heightened as a result of this incident. Experts suggest that the attack could indicate a growing need for enhanced surveillance and security measures around critical government infrastructures.

In response to the incident, there has been an increased presence of law enforcement in Brasília. This presence is intended to reassure the public and prevent any further incidents. Federal police are collaborating with local authorities to ensure comprehensive security coverage in the city.

Local residents expressed shock and concern over the attack. Some witnesses recounted their experiences of the explosions and the subsequent evacuation. Many expressed relief that the situation was handled without further casualties.
